Product Description

This product is formulated using premium hydrogenated base oil, combined with a blend of high-quality additives—including extreme-pressure, anti-wear, antioxidant, rust-inhibiting, and anti-corrosion agents—carefully blended on a specialized cleaning production line.

Product Performance

High cleanliness reduces clogging and damage to precision servo valves or other hydraulic components;

Excellent thermal stability and oxidation resistance extend the service life of the oil.

Excellent demulsibility and hydrolytic stability enhance the oil's resistance to contamination;

Excellent anti-foaming and air-release properties ensure the system transmits hydrostatic pressure smoothly, accurately, and with high responsiveness.

Excellent wear resistance meets the requirements of components such as medium- and high-pressure hydraulic systems and oil pumps, effectively extending equipment lifespan.

Technical Specifications

GB 11118.1-2011

Scope of application

Designed specifically for precision-sensitive servo-hydraulic systems requiring high cleanliness, it meets the demanding needs of sophisticated hydraulic control systems used in industries such as mining machinery, marine applications, and metallurgical steel production.

Instructions for Use and Precautions

According to equipment lubrication guidelines, select oil products with appropriate viscosity. During use and storage/transportation, prevent contamination by foreign objects and strictly avoid mixing in mechanical impurities or water. Ensure the oil tank remains clean—when changing the oil, thoroughly flush both the tank and oil lines—and never mix it with oils of different types.

Storage Conditions

1. Packaged in 200L iron drums or 1000L IBC totes.

2. Store in a cool, well-ventilated area, away from fire sources and direct sunlight.

3. Recommendation: The maximum processing temperature should not exceed 70°C, and the long-term storage temperature must remain below 45°C.
